Exploring the Impact of Edge Computing on IoT Security in Industrial Applications

The Role of Edge Computing in Enhancing IoT Security

Industrial IoT (IIoT) applications have transformed the way businesses operate by enabling real-time monitoring, automation, and data analytics. However, the widespread adoption of IoT devices in industrial environments has raised concerns about security vulnerabilities and potential cyber threats. Edge computing has emerged as a powerful solution to address these security challenges and enhance the overall resilience of IIoT systems.

Understanding Edge Computing

Edge computing involves processing data closer to the source or ‘edge’ of the network, rather than relying on a centralized cloud infrastructure. By bringing computation and data storage closer to IoT devices, edge computing reduces latency, bandwidth usage, and enhances privacy and security.

Enhanced Security Measures

One of the key advantages of edge computing in industrial IoT applications is its ability to improve security measures. By processing data locally at the edge, sensitive information can be secured and encrypted before being transmitted to the cloud or central servers. This minimizes the risk of data breaches and unauthorized access.

Real-Time Threat Detection

Edge computing enables real-time processing and analysis of data streams generated by IoT devices. This allows for immediate detection of anomalies, unusual patterns, and potential security threats. By implementing machine learning algorithms at the edge, IIoT systems can quickly respond to security incidents and mitigate risks proactively.

Isolation of Critical Systems

Edge computing also enables the isolation of critical systems from the broader network, reducing the attack surface and limiting the impact of security breaches. By segmenting IoT devices into secure zones and implementing access controls at the edge, organizations can strengthen their overall cybersecurity posture.

Conclusion

Edge computing plays a crucial role in enhancing IoT security in industrial applications by providing real-time processing, enhanced data security, and proactive threat detection capabilities. By leveraging edge computing technologies, businesses can build more resilient and secure IIoT systems that protect sensitive data and mitigate cyber risks effectively.
